STIR-FRIED BEEF NOODLES WITH BLACK BEAN GARLIC SAUCE



Stir-Fried Beef Noodles with Black Bean Garlic Sauce image

Stir-Fried Beef Noodles with Black Bean Garlic Sauce

Provided by bestrecipesuk

Categories     Meals in minutes     Mid Week Meals

Time 17m

Yield 2

Number Of Ingredients 12

lean beef steak
garlic clove
fresh root ginger
Lee Kum Kee Premium Dark Soy Sauce
Toasted Sesame oil
freshly ground salt & pepper
vegetable oil
red pepper
spring onions
bean sprout & stir fry vegetable mix
medium egg noodles
Lee Kum Kee Black Bean Garlic Stir-fry Sauce

Steps:

  • Bring a pan of salted water to the boil for the noodles.
  • Place the thinly sliced steak into a bowl and toss with 1 tablespoon of soy sauce, a drizzle of sesame oil and a pinch each of salt and pepper. Crush in the garlic, add the grated ginger and mix well. Leave to marinade for a few minutes while you prepare the rest of the vegetables.
  • Heat a wok or a large frying pan until hot then add 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il, and a touch of sesame oil, swirling the wok to coat the surface evenly. Add the beef strips and stir-fry for a couple of minutes until nicely browned.
  • Now add the red pepper and spring onions and stir-fry for 2-3 minutes. Add the bean sprouts for the last 30 seconds.
  • Blanch the noodles in the boiling water for about 3-4 minutes, until tender but still retaining a slight bite, then drain and immediately toss with the beef and vegetables. Now add the Black Bean Garlic sauce and stir until warmed through.
  • Divide between bowls and serve, enjoy!

EASY BEEF IN BLACK BEAN RECIPE



Easy Beef In Black Bean Recipe image

Easy beef in black bean sauce recipe made with tender beef steak, fermented black beans, peppers and delicious stir fry sauce. Make Chinese restaurant quality dish at home in 30 minutes.

Provided by Khin

Categories     Main Course

Number Of Ingredients 19

300 g Beef steak (about 10.5 oz ( ribeye, sirloin, rump, chuck, etc. ) cut into thin slices)
½ Green pepper (bell pepper/capsicum ( cut in small squares ))
½ Red pepper (bell pepper/capsicum ( cut in small squares ))
1 Onion (cut in small cubes)
1½ tbsp Garlic (finely chopped)
1 tsp Ginger (paste or finley grated)
1 tbsp Black bean (fermented black beans or black bean sauce ( details in note ))
2 tbsp Oil (vegetable, sunflower, canola, or neutral flavour oil)
1 tbsp Sugar
1 tsp Corn starch
½ tsp Baking soda
1 tbsp Light soy sauce (or regular soy sauce)
1 tbsp Shao Xing wine (optional ( details in note ))
3 tbsp Oyster sauce
1 tsp Dark soy sauce
3 tbsp Water
½ tsp Corn starch
2 tsp Shao Xing Wine
2 tsp Sugar

Steps:

  • Cut the beef steak into thin slices against the grain. Marinate the beef with soy sauce, sugar, Shao Xing wine, baking soda and corn starch. Mix well and let it sit for 10-15 minutes. Mix all the stir fry sauce ingredients in a small bowl and set it aside. Roughly chop the black beans or you can add in whole.
  • Heat the wok/pan over medium-high heat, drizzle oil, and add the marinated beef slices. Flatted the beef and let it sear for 2-3 minutes then turn sides and stir fry for another 2-3 minutes. Next, add the onion dices and stir fry for 1 minute. Follow with the bell peppers and stir for few seconds. Remove from pan and set it aside.
  • In the remaining pan, drizzle a bit more oil. Saute the chopped garlic with medium heat for 1 minute, then follow with the ginger and stir for few seconds. Add the black beans stir fry for 1-2 minutes. Then pour the sauce mixture, stir unil the sauce start to get thick.
  • Add the fried beef, onions and peppers in. Bring to heat over medium-high heat. Toss well to combine everything evenly for 1-2 minutes.
  • Remove from heat and transfer to serving plate. Serve while hot with plain rice, egg fried rice or noodles.

BEEF AND BROCCOLI WITH BLACK-BEAN GARLIC SAUCE



Beef and Broccoli with Black-Bean Garlic Sauce image

Better than takeout? We think so! What really sets this beef-and-broccoli stir-fry apart is the addition of black-bean garlic sauce, a rich and super-savory Chinese condiment made with fermented black beans, garlic, and chilis into a rich and super savory paste that soaks into this stir-fry with aplomb.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dinner Recipes

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 pound skirt steak, cut into 1/2-inch-thick slices
4 teaspoons cornstarch
1/2 cup low-sodium chicken broth
2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ger (from a 2-inch piece)
2 tablespoons black-bean garlic sauce, such as Kikkoman or Lee Kum Kee
1 teaspoon sugar
2 teaspoons toasted sesame oil
1/4 cup vegetable oil
4 cups small broccoli florets (from 1 head)
3 scallions, white and light-green parts thinly sliced (1/2 cup), plus darker greens, sliced, for serving
Cooked rice, for serving

Steps:

  • Pat meat dry, then toss with 3 teaspoons cornstarch. Stir together broth, ginger, black-bean sauce, sugar, sesame oil, and remaining 1 teaspoon cornstarch in a bowl. Measure 2 tablespoons water in a separate small bowl and set aside.
  • Heat a large, heavy skillet (preferably cast iron) or wok over high for 3 minutes. Swirl in 2 tablespoons vegetable oil. Working in batches to avoid crowding pan, brown meat, about 1 minute per side. Transfer to a plate.
  • Swirl in remaining vegetable oil and add broccoli. Cook, stirring occasionally, until broccoli begins to brown, about 3 minutes. Add reserved water and toss until broccoli is bright green and tender, 1 to 2 minutes more.
  • Add white and light-green parts of scallion to skillet along with meat and any accumulated juices. Stir in black-bean-sauce mixture and toss until evenly coated and sauce has thickened, about 30 seconds. Serve with rice, sprinkled with scallion greens.

BEEF WITH BLACK BEAN SAUCE



Beef with Black Bean Sauce image

Beef with black bean sauce is a tasty, classic combination found on Chinese restaurant menus around the country, and it's easy to make at home!

Provided by Sarah

Categories     Beef

Time 1h30m

Number Of Ingredients 20

1 pound beef flank steak or beef chuck ((thinly sliced against the grain))
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 cup water
2 teaspoons cornstarch
2 teaspoons vegetable oil
2 teaspoons oyster sauce
1 teaspoon Shaoxing wine
1 1/2 cups low sodium beef or chicken stock
2 tablespoons black bean and garlic sauce ((such as Lee Kum Kee))
1 tablespoon oyster sauce
1/2 teaspoon sugar
1/2 teaspoon dark soy sauce
1/2 teaspoon sesame oil
1/8 teaspoon ground white pepper ((or to taste))
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
2/3 cup onion ((cut into 1-inch/2.5cm pieces))
1 cup red bell pepper ((cut into 1-inch/2.5cm pieces))
1 tablespoon Shaoxing wine
1 cup snow peas ((trimmed))
1 1/2 tablespoons cornstarch ((mixed into a slurry with 2 tablespoons water))

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l, add the beef, baking soda, and water. Massage the beef with your hands until most of the liquid is absorbed. Let stand for 1 to 2 hours (less time for more tender beef, or longer for a tougher cut like chuck). Then rinse the beef thoroughly under running water until the water runs clear. Drain. This step tenderizes the meat before marinating.
  • Then add the cornstarch, vegetable oil, oyster sauce, and Shaoxing wine. Mix well and marinate the beef for at least 30 minutes, or even overnight if you'd like to make this ahead.
  • In a liquid measuring cup, mix together the stock, black bean garlic sauce, oyster sauce, dark soy sauce, sesame oil, sugar, and white pepper, and set aside.
  • Heat your wok over high heat until it starts to smoke lightly. Add 1 tablespoon of oil around the perimeter of the wok. Add the beef in 1 layer, and sear the beef on both sides until browned (this should only take 2-3 minutes). Turn off the heat, remove the beef from the wok, and set aside.
  • Reduce the heat to medium-high, and add the remaining 1 tablespoon of oil, onions, and bell peppers. Stir-fry for 30 seconds, until the onions and peppers have very light sear on them. Next, add the Shaoxing wine to deglaze the wok.
  • Stir in the sauce mixture you made earlier. Bring to a simmer, and add the beef (along with any juices) back to the wok. Stir it in, then add the snow peas.
  • Bring the contents of the wok to a simmer. Stir the cornstarch and water until incorporated into a slurry, and gradually add the slurry to the sauce, stirring constantly until the sauce is thickened to your liking (if it's too thick, add a splash of water or stock; if it's too thin, add more slurry). Cook until the snow peas are just crisp-tender. Serve immediately with steamed rice!

EASY BEEF IN BLACK BEAN SAUCE



Easy beef in black bean sauce image

Try this simple stir-fry using tender rump steak, peppers, ginger, chilli and garlic. Opt for a good quality black bean sauce - it will make all the difference

Provided by Esther Clark

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 x 250g rump steaks
1 tbsp cornflour
2 tbsp sesame oil
1 large white onion, cut into thin wedges
1 red pepper, deseeded and sliced
1 green pepper, deseeded and sliced
2 fat garlic cloves, crushed
1 thumb-sized piece ginger, peeled and grated
1-2 red chillies, finely chopped
5 tbsp black bean sauce
1 tbsp rice wine vinegar
2 tsp sugar
sticky rice, to serve
coriander leaves, to serve (optional)

Steps:

  • Remove the thick layer of fat running down the side of the steaks and discard. Slice the steak into 1cm-thick, long strips and toss with the cornflour and some seasoning.
  • Heat the oil in a large frying pan or wok over a high heat then add the steak, frying for 3-5 mins or until golden brown on the outside. Remove with a slotted spoon and transfer to a plate.
  • Add the onion and peppers to the pan and fry for 6-7 mins or until beginning to soften. Stir through the garlic, ginger and chilli and cook for a further min. Return the beef to the pan and stir through the black bean sauce, rice wine vinegar, sugar and 2 tbsp water to loosen a little. Bring to a simmer and then remove from the heat.
  • Serve the stir-fry in deep bowls with mounds of sticky rice and top with coriander, if you like.
